As temperatures rise, your HVAC system will begin working hard to keep your home cool and comfortable. Mild spring weather, therefore, presents the perfect opportunity for getting your AC summer-ready and scheduling any preventative HVAC services you may need. Here are a few simple steps you can take to keep the unit in optimal condition through the spring and beyond.

Springtime HVAC Maintenance Steps

1. Clean Around Your Outdoor Unit

Your outdoor unit can become clogged from debris like dirt and pollen, causing sluggish performance. Remove any buildup using a clean cloth while the system is off, and clear away any overgrowth of vegetation. Check the coils, too; wipe them down as needed to prevent performance issues.

2. Change or Clean the Filter

HVAC servicesThe filter in your HVAC system collects particles like pet dander and dust, which restrict airflow and minimize efficiency. Swap out the old filter for a new one or clean it if you have a permanent one. Doing so can help you reduce the system’s energy consumption by 5% to 15%.

3. Prepare Your Dehumidifier

Many areas experience high levels of humidity during the summer. If you have a dehumidifier to help keep your home comfortable, prepare it by removing its exterior casing. Allow it to dry thoroughly, then gently remove any excess buildup with a vacuum attachment.

4. Consider a Smart Thermostat

Unlike traditional thermostats, smart thermostats can be powered remotely from your mobile device. You can adjust the temperature when you’re not home, reducing the strain on the system and helping to control cooling costs throughout the season.

5. Schedule HVAC Services

Beyond the steps you can take on your own, you should also enlist professional HVAC services to perform preventative maintenance on your system. Technicians will inspect the components, including the compressor, fan motor, and refrigerant levels, for signs of any issues. They’ll address them proactively before they become bigger problems, helping to save you money and optimize the unit’s efficiency.
